首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如果有三个实例,则删除行

删除行是指在数据库中删除一条记录或者在编程中删除一个对象。删除行操作可以通过执行SQL语句或者调用相应的API来实现。

删除行的步骤如下:

  1. 首先,需要确定要删除的行所在的表和条件。可以使用SELECT语句查询出符合条件的行,以便确认要删除的内容。
  2. 然后,使用DELETE语句或者相应的API来执行删除操作。DELETE语句的基本语法如下:
  3. 然后,使用DELETE语句或者相应的API来执行删除操作。DELETE语句的基本语法如下:
  4. 其中,表名是要删除行所在的表的名称,条件是指定要删除的行的条件。API的使用方式根据具体的编程语言和数据库系统而有所不同。
  5. 最后,确认删除操作是否成功。可以再次执行SELECT语句或者查询相应的API来验证删除操作是否生效。

删除行的优势:

  • 节省存储空间:删除不再需要的行可以释放数据库的存储空间,提高数据库的性能和效率。
  • 维护数据一致性:删除不需要的行可以保持数据库中的数据一致性,避免数据冗余和错误。
  • 提高查询效率:删除不需要的行可以减少查询时的数据量,提高查询的速度和效率。

删除行的应用场景:

  • 用户管理:删除不活跃或者已注销的用户信息。
  • 订单管理:删除已完成或者已取消的订单记录。
  • 日志管理:删除过期的日志记录,以减少存储空间占用。

腾讯云相关产品和产品介绍链接地址:

  • 云数据库 TencentDB:提供高性能、可扩展的云数据库服务,支持主流数据库引擎,满足不同业务场景的需求。详细信息请参考:https://cloud.tencent.com/product/cdb
  • 云服务器 CVM:提供弹性、安全、稳定的云服务器实例,可满足不同规模和需求的应用场景。详细信息请参考:https://cloud.tencent.com/product/cvm
  • 云存储 COS:提供安全、稳定、低成本的云存储服务,适用于图片、音视频、文档等各类数据的存储和管理。详细信息请参考:https://cloud.tencent.com/product/cos
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在 Excel 工作簿中定义决策表(Oracle Policy Modeling-Define decision tables in Excel workbooks)

因为我们将只有一组条件,所以您可以删除第一个条件列。  b.将文本结论替换为“哪国人”。此单元格已采用正确的结论标题样式。因为我们将只有一组结论,所以您可以删除另一个结论列。  ...删除随后两,因为这些不会用到。    1.在下面的中,输入另一个条件“苏格兰”,关联的结论为“苏格兰人”。按照此方法处理下一,条件为“日本”,结论为“日本人”。    ...如果有多个条件证明同一结论,我们还可以合并结论值的单元格。 ? 这样可以简化 Excel 规则表的外观,强调为门票推断的值在多个可能方案中相同。...如果表的第一无法 求值(即如果有些条件值未知),即使表中后面的因为其所有条件值完全已知而可以求值,规则表整体的 求值也不会超过第一。 在某些情况下,这不是规则求值的最有用方式。...但是,如果我们合并包含适用于这两的结论的单元格, Oracle Policy Modeling 生成的内部规则 会将这些与单个规则表中的“或者”条件合并,而不是上面生成的两个单独规则表

4.1K30
  • 技术干货| 腾讯云TDSQL多源同步架构与特性详解

    从上图我们可以看到,整个系统可以大致分成三个部分:producter,store,consumer。...MySQL在记录binlog时,按照事务的提交顺序将的改动写入binlog文件,因此按照binlog文件记录事件的顺序进行串行重放,源端和目标端数据库实例状态一定会达到一致。...因为线程间的执行顺序是完全并发的,因此这三个操作在两个线程间的执行顺序可能为以下几种情况。 1)线程1比线程2执行得早 ? 目标实例这种执行顺序与源实例的执行顺序完全一致,不会造成数据的不一致。...之后线程1再执行删除操作时,也会进入幂等流程(因为(1,Lucy,8)不存在,delete的影响行数为0),最终目标实例的状态是存在记录(2,lucy,20)。结果正确,不会造成不一致。...因此这里锁的语义应该是,如果有前序包含相同唯一索引值的事件没有执行完,则需要等待,待其执行完后再执行当前事件。consumer的锁结构如下所示: ?

    5.7K73

    Linux常用命令速查-文件管理

    rm fileName 常用参数: -f 强制删除(不询问) -r 删除目录 -rf 强制删除目录(不询问) 创建文件 touch fileName 移动文件目录或重命名文件目录 mv...]: 向上翻动一页 查看文件开头 head fileName 常用参数: 默认显示文件前10 -c num 显示每个文件的前num 字节内容;如果附加"-"参数(-c -n),除了每个文件的最后...num字节数据外 显示剩余全部内容 -n num 显示每个文件的前num 行内容;如果附加"-"参数,除了每个文件的最后num 外 显示剩余全部内容 查看文件末尾 tail 常用参数:...权限的分类: r 读权限:可以打开文件、目录读取查看; w 写权限:对文件、目录可以编写更改; x 执行权限:对文件可执行 先看个实例: [root@master1 ~]#...r,没有权限则为- 第三个字符表示所有者写权限,如果有权限则为w,没有权限则为- 第四个字符表示所有者执行权限,如果有权限则为x,没有权限则为- 第五个字符表示所有者同组用户读权限,如果有权限则为r,没有权限则为

    1.4K00

    怎么正经的实现shell脚本单例运行?

    看起来可行的方法 一个非常简单的思路就是,新的脚本被执行时,先检测当前脚本是否有其他实例正在运行,如果有直接退出。 #!...我们来回顾一下,这是一个怎样的过程: 1.运行前检查是否有该锁文件,并且文件中的进程正在运行 2.如果有并且程序正在运行,则已经有实例在运行 3.否则,无实例,创建锁文件,写入进程id 4.退出时,删除锁文件...解释一下第一条,为什么一定要确定锁文件中的进程正在运行,因为,有些情况下如果运行的时候退出没有删除该文件,则会导致新的实例永远无法运行。...= "$0" ] && exec env FLOCKER="$0" flock -en "$0" "$0" "$@" || : 在脚本开头加上上面这么一就可以了。例如: #!...总结 单例运行本身思路是很简单的,就是探测当前是否有实例在运行,如果有退出,但是这里如何判断,却并不是那么容易。

    2.3K20

    『工作自动化』文件内容差异化对比辅助工具difflib

    ' 不存在于任一输入序列 这里的序列是指用于对比的两个文件的内容,以 '?' 打头的不属于任何一个序列。...++++++\n', '- 如果有更多的需求,我们会在后续文档里输出\n', '? -\n', '+ 如果有更多需求,我们会持续在后续文档里输出\n', '?...++++++ - 如果有更多的需求,我们会在后续文档里输出 ? - + 如果有更多需求,我们会持续在后续文档里输出 ?...++ 谢谢 在输出结果中,^表示有变化的字符位置,-表示被删除的字符位置,+表示新增的字符位置。 大家可能会发现,目前这三个标识符和实际变化的位置对不上。是的,因为目前案例中是中文字符。。。...我们先实例化一个difflib.HtmlDiff对象,任何调用make_file方法获取结果写入xx.html文件即可获取差异。

    58910

    学好vim一篇就够了-vi和vim的使用教程

    如果有问题快速回到文档编辑页面fg,再按u。...x 【删除光标所在字符】 nx 【删除光标所在处后n个字符】 dd 【删除光标所在行,ndd删除n】 dG...【删除光标所在行到末尾的内容】 D 【删除从光标所在处到行尾】 :n1,n2d 【删除指定的】 :10,20d 【删除第十到第20的内容...fa(或fb) 【查询这行a字母的的地方(或b字母)】 3fa 【在这行中查找a出现的第三个位置】 应用实例 导入其他文件内容 :...总结 以上的常用命令和操作都是基于vim的基本原理形成的,vim的命令很强大,尤其底命令模式甚至可以类似于一个小型的脚本语言。 如果有遗漏,欢迎留言告知,谢谢!

    1K20

    初探Java源码之ArrayList

    我们看到主要有三个构造方法。 (1)第一个构造方法需要传入一个int类型的变量。表示我们实例化一个ArrayList的时候想让ArrayList的初始化长度为多少。...(3)第三个我们另外一种常见的使用方法,比如处理化AList的时候想把BList的值传给AList。 那么使用如下代码: ? 我们看看构造函数做了什么。...然后判断elementData数组里面是否有数据元素,如果有,那么再判断elementData数组类型是否为Object,不是的话,转为Object类型。...可以看到add()方法还是比较简短的,接下面我们一步一步的分析,第一是调用了一个方法,第二是常见的数组赋值,将下标为size处的数组元素赋值为e,然后size自加1。如果有意识的话,会想到,咦?...有问题抛出异常。负责又调用ensureCapacityInternal()方法来确认数组长度是否足够。然后调用System.arraycopy()方法,我们来看看: ?

    47910

    Python内置函数详解【翻译自pyth

    显式级别为0(无优化; __debug__为真),1(声明被删除,__debug__为假 )或2(docstrings也被删除)。...如果有全局变量,globals必须是个字典。如果有局部变量,locals可以是任何映射类型对象。...input([prompt]) 如果有prompt参数,则将它输出到标准输出且不带换行。该函数然后从标准输入读取一,将它转换成一个字符串(去掉一个末尾的换行符),然后返回它。...如果它是'',启用通用换行符模式,但结尾将返回给调用者而不会转换。如果它具有任何其它合法值,输入行仅由给定字符串终止,并且结尾被返回给调用者而不会转换。...如果第二个参数为负数,那么第三个参数必须省略。

    1.5K20

    MySQL必知必会分页whereupdatelimit字符串截取order by排序ength和char_lengthreplace函数1 键2 数据库事务的ACID3 视图4 删除连接

    4 删除 drop直接删掉表 truncate删除表中数据,再插入时自增长id又从1开始 delete删除表中数据,可以加where字句 (1) DELETE 每次从表中删除,并同时将该行的删除操作作为事务记录在日志中保存...,以便回滚 TRUNCATE TABLE 一次性地从表中删除所有的数据,并不把单独的删除操作记录记入日志保存,删除是不能恢复的,在删除的过程中不会激活与表有关的删除触发器。...而DROP删除整个表(结构和数据) (6) truncate与不带where的delete :只删除数据,而不删除表的结构(定义) drop语句将删除表的结构被依赖的约束(constrain),触发器...DELETE 语句每次删除,并在事务日志中为所删除的每行记录一项。TRUNCATE TABLE 通过释放存储表数据所用的数据页来删除数据,并且只在事务日志中记录页的释放。...(10) TRUNCATE TABLE 删除表中的所有,但表结构及其列、约束、索引等保持不变。新标识所用的计数值重置为该列的种子。 如果想保留标识计数值,请改用 DELETE。

    2.2K140

    Tomcat NIO(11)-请求数据读取

    对于 tomcat 请求数据的读取来说,可以分为请求的读取,请求头的读取,请求体的读取,三个部分方法调用序列图如下: 读取请求 ? 读取请求头 ? 读取请求体 ?...综合上面三个序列图,对于请求,请求头,请求体的读取都最终调用了NioSocketWrapper 对象实例的 fillReadBuffer() 方法。...在该方法中又会调用 NioBlockingSelector 的 read() 方法,核心代码如下: 根据以上代码整个读数据逻辑在一个循环里进行,如果有数据读到就跳出循环,返回数据。...如果没有数据,调用 BlockPoller 的 add() 方法,该方法将封装的 OP_READ 事件添加到 BlockPoller 的事件队列里。...对于请求体的读取是阻塞的读取,如果发现请求体数据不可读,那么首先注册封装的 OP_READ 事件到 BlockPoller 对象实例的事件队列里。

    85360

    聊一聊 MySQL 数据库中的那些锁

    全局锁 全局锁是粒度最大的锁,基本上也使用不上,就像我们家的大门一样,控制着整个数据库实例。全局锁就是对整个数据库实例加锁,让整个数据库处于只读状态。...因此,如果有两个线程要同时给一个表加字段,其中一个要等另一个执行完才能开始执行。...级锁比较容易理解,比如事务 A 更新了一,而这时候事务 B 也要更新同一必须等事务 A 的操作完成后才能进行更新。...InnoDB 引擎实现了级锁,InnoDB 存储引擎中实现了两种标准的级锁: 共享锁(S Lock):允许事务读一 排它锁(X Lock):允许事务删除和更新一 共享锁是兼容锁,就是当一个事务已经获得了...排他锁是非兼容锁,如果有事务想获取 r 的排他锁,若 r 上有共享锁或者排它锁,它必须等其他事务释放行 r 的锁。

    56610

    数据分析基础——EXCEL快速上手秘籍

    所有公式均结合实例(本节课以小例子为主),讲为辅,练为主,实例数据附在文章最后,也可在公众号导航栏“实战数据”获取。 陈独秀(基础扎实)童鞋可以直接跳过,其他同鞋可以当做回顾和复习。...那是因为,我们源数据格式是酱紫的,数据透视表分组逻辑是判断是否唯一,如果唯一单独分为一(或一列),想要把标签的日期格式变成月的维度,也HIN简单。...1.3、删除重复项: 顾名思义,就是删掉重复的项,这个项指的是。 ? 选中数据,点击“数据”选项卡下的“删除重复项” ? 弹出删除界面: ?...默认是全选,但一定要慎重,假如我们单勾选A,就是只判断A列中的值是否重复,若重复删去(单选B删B),这里我们选单选A尝试, 结果反馈: ? 删除后的数据: ?...因此,需要同时判断姓名和城市,如果都重复才会删除,只有一个重复保留。要实现这个逻辑,只需要按照默认勾选,同时选A和B就可以了,结果如下: ? OKAY~That is it!

    2K10

    数据分析基础——EXCEL快速上手秘籍

    所有公式均结合实例(本节课以小例子为主),讲为辅,练为主,实例数据附在文章最后,也可在公众号导航栏“实战数据”获取。 陈独秀(基础扎实)童鞋可以直接跳过,其他同鞋可以当做回顾和复习。...那是因为,我们源数据格式是酱紫的,数据透视表分组逻辑是判断是否唯一,如果唯一单独分为一(或一列),想要把标签的日期格式变成月的维度,也HIN简单。...1.3、删除重复项: 顾名思义,就是删掉重复的项,这个项指的是。 ? 选中数据,点击“数据”选项卡下的“删除重复项” ? 弹出删除界面: ?...默认是全选,但一定要慎重,假如我们单勾选A,就是只判断A列中的值是否重复,若重复删去(单选B删B),这里我们选单选A尝试, 结果反馈: ? 删除后的数据: ?...因此,需要同时判断姓名和城市,如果都重复才会删除,只有一个重复保留。要实现这个逻辑,只需要按照默认勾选,同时选A和B就可以了,结果如下: ? OKAY~That is it!

    2K00

    SQL语句使用总结(一)

    那么以一个实例为主。  使用FOR XML PATH('')),1,1,'')语句。...什么是并发访问:同一时间有多个用户访问同一资源,并发用户中如果有用户对资源做了修改,此时就会对其它用户产生某些不利的影响,例如: 1:脏读,一个用户对一个资源做了修改,此时另外一个用户正好读取了这条被修改的记录...将 OUTPUT 用于 DELETE 语句    以下实例是将在表中soloreztest删除是放回被删除的信息      delete soloreztest  output deleted.*...同理以上也可使用会 output into语句将被删除的信息插入到一个新表中 C....www.cnblogs.com/fygh/archive/2011/08/31/2160266.html 好处: 1) WITH AS存储过程中使用,声明了就一定要用,不然会报错. 2) 存储过程中如果有

    94610
    领券